Why does your dog need regular grooming?

Frequent grooming of your pet not only keeps your pet’s hair looking fantastic, but it also helps maintain your pet’s skin and physical health and wellbeing. When your pet gets grooming, it helps it avoid painful tangling and knots in their hair, prevents the build-up of bacteria and hot-spots (dermatitis), and keeps thedog away from pests like fleas. Within your dog’s grooming appointment, your North Terre Haute dog groomer will look out for lumps and injuries that could progress into a health problem.


How often should my dog be groomed?

Grooming needs for your dog will differ depending on the breed, hair and your dog’s habits. Generally, dogs with short coats such as Beagles, Bulldogs and Labradors need less grooming than long haired dogs like Poodles, Border Collies and Pomeranians. As a general rule, most pet owners book frequent grooming on a monthly basis. For young puppies and dogs who have not been groomed yet, more frequent grooming at home should be done to get them used to being handled and to prevent grooming problems into adulthood. What’s the difference between a dog bathing and grooming service?

Dog bathing services consist of: 1-3 sets of shampoo, 1 round of conditioner, hand-dry as permitted by pet, brush and/or comb out.

Pet grooming include: Everything included from bathing plus a full cut/style based on breed standards and/or your personal needs, nails trimmed, and ears cleaned.

Why does my pet smell even after grooming?

There are numerous reasons why a dog’s skin might be jeopardized, leading to a skin infection. Allergies, hormonal imbalances, fungal infections, external parasites, inflammation, injuries, bleeding tumors, and other skin issues can trigger bacteria and fungus on the skin’s surface area to take hold and make repulsive scents.

Is it OK to use conditioner on canines?

Just like shampoo, it is important to use just doggie conditioners on your animal. The veterinarians warn pet owners that human grooming items, whether conditioner or bar soap, can cause undesirable skin irritation in canines.
